U.S. Pat. No. 10,543,424

PROGRAMMABLE HAND-HELD VIDEO GAMING CONTROLLER WITH INTEGRATED FOOT-PEDAL GAMING CONTROLLER PLATFORM

Issue DateJune 6, 2019

Illustrative Figure

Abstract

A gaming platform including a programmable hand-held video gaming controller in electrical communication with an integrated foot-pedal gaming controller. The programmable hand-held video gaming controller including at least one game function activation area, each of the at least one game function activation areas operating a game function, each of the at least one game function activation areas further including a function control transfer switch. The integrated foot-pedal gaming controller platform including at least one foot pedal configured to control at least one game function when a corresponding function control transfer switch on the programmable hand-held video gaming controller is activated.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ION

FIG. 1illustrates an exemplary layout of the programmable hand-held video gaming controller10of the present disclosure. Game controller10is electrically coupled to an integ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12(seeFIG. 2) either via wires or wirelessly, through communication methods commonly known in the electrical arts. Both game controller10and integ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12are fully operable to provide control to various gaming features as commonly known in the art. Both game controller10and integ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12include the necessary hardware, software, memory, and electrical circuits to provide a fully-programmable video game controller module as is currently known in the art.

Game controller10includes one or more game function activation areas14, each of which includes game control buttons, switches, levers, etc., commonly known in the art to allow a user to control specific game functions. Each game function activation areas14also includes a game function transfer switch16that is configured to perform a variety of functions. The present disclosure is not limited to the exact type of gaming functions that can be performed by the activation of switch16. Further, switch16can be a push button, or any other type of switch commonly known in the art.

Game controller10may, in certain embodiments, also include indicator lights18and20. Indicator lights18and20are located in each game function activation area14. Indicator lights18indicate which side of integ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12control for that specific game function has been transferred to. For example, if control of the function associated with a particular game function activation areas14is transferred to the left side of integ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12then indicator light18will show an “L” and if the control of the game function has been transferred to the right side of the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12then indicator light18will show an “R”.

Similarly, indicator lights20indicate which pedal of integ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12control for that specific game function has been transferred to. For example, if control of the function associated with a particular game function activation areas14is transferred to the first pedal of integ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12then indicator light20will show a “1” and if the control of the game function has been transferred to the second pedal of the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12then indicator light20will show an “2”. Thus, for example, if control of a particular game function has been transferred to the second pedal of the right side of integ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12indicator light18will show an “R” and indicator light20will show a “2.” In this fashion, the user can easily see which pedals are not controlling this particular game function.

An exemplary methodology of how game function controls are transferred to foot pedals will now be discussed. Referring now to bothFIG. 1andFIG. 2, in one embodiment, when switch16located in a game function activation area14is activated for a first time, instead of the selected game function associated with the game controls in the function activation area14remaining in the control of game controller10as is traditional, the selected game function is transferred to a corresponding foot pedal on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12. For example, when switch16is activated a first time, the gaming function that would normally be initiated by the activation of switch16is instead transferred to a corresponding pedal located on foot pedal gaming controller platform12, e.g., the first pedal22on the left side of the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12, as shown inFIG. 2. This allows the user to control this particular game function by activating the corresponding foot pedal, i.e., pedal22on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12, rather than controlling the game function via use of game controller10. As described above, in one embodiment, corresponding indicator lights18and20on gaming controller10may be illuminated to thus indicate that control of this particular game function has been transferred from game controller10to a corresponding foot pedal on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12, for instance, the first pedal22on the left side of integ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12, as shown inFIG. 2. In another embodiment, indicator lights18and20on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form4are also illuminated to indicate to the user which foot pedal is currently controlling a game function.

In other embodiments, when switch16on game controller10is activated a second time, the game function that would normally be controlled by switch16is transferred to a different foot pedal, i.e., different from the foot pedal that controls the game function when switch16is activated for a first time. For example, when switch16is activated a second time, the function that would normally be activated by the actuation of switch16on game controller10is transferred to a different foot pedal on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12. For example, this foot pedal could be the second pedal24on the left side of the integrated foot-pedal gaming controller platform12, as shown inFIG. 2. Again, in one embodiment, corresponding indicator lights18and20on game controller10and indicator lights on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12may be illuminated to indicate that control of this particular game function has been transferred to a corresponding foot pedal on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12, for instance second pedal24on the left side of integ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12.

In another embodiment, when switch16is activated a third time, the function that would normally be associated with switch16on game controller10is transferred to a different foot pedal on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12, i.e., different from the foot pedal to which control of the game function was transferred when switch16was activated a first time and the foot pedal to which control of the game function was transferred when switch16was activated a second time. For example, this foot pedal could be the first pedal26on the right side of integ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12. In one embodiment, corresponding indicator lights18and20on game controller10and indicator lights on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12may be illuminated to indicate that this particular game function has been transferred to a corresponding pedal on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12, for instance, the first pedal26on the right side of integ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12.

In another embodiment, when switch16is activated a fourth time, the function that would normally be activated by the activation of switch16on game controller10is transferred to a different foot pedal on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12, i.e., different from the foot pedal to which control of the game function was transferred when switch16was activated a first time, the foot pedal to which control of the game function was transferred when switch16was activated a second time, and the foot pedal to which control of the game function was transferred when switch16was activated a third time. For example, this foot pedal to which control is transferred could be the second pedal28on the right side of integ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12. In one embodiment, corresponding indicator lights18and20on both game controller10and indicator lights on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12may be illuminated to indicate that this particular game function has been coupled to a corresponding pedal on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12, in this instance, the second pedal28on the right side of integ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12.

In still another embodiment, when switch16on game controller10is activated a fifth time, all connections to integ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12are deactivated along with corresponding indicator lights18and20on game controller10and integ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12, returning control of the function back to the hand-held game controller10.

Note that the number and order of activations of the switch16given above to transfer control of a game function from game controller10to a specific pedal on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12is exemplary only. Thus, the present disclosure is not limited to the exact number of switch16activations or the order of switch16activations indicated above. Thus, for example, a first activation of switch16may transfer control to, for example, the first pedal26on the right side of integ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12. Further, activating switch16may result in different operations. For example, in one embodiment, if switch16is activated for a first time, instead of the game function remaining in the control of game controller10, the selected function is coupled to a foot pedal on the integrated foot pedal gaming control platform14. If switch16is pressed two times, control of that gaming function is moved to a different pedal on the integrated foot pedal gaming platform14. However, if switch16is activated three times, the connection of the indicated function to the pedals of the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form14and push button and indicators is deactivated, returning control of the function solely to hand-held game controller10.

The term “transferring” as used herein may mean that total control of a game function is transferred from game controller10to integ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12and control of that game function in the hand-held game controller10is deactivated, or it may mean that control of this game function is shared between both hand-held game controller10and integ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12. This latter embodiment may be advantageous for example “in the heat of battle” during gaming when gamers may wish to use both the hand held game controller10and foot pedals on the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12without having to think about which apparatus is currently controlling the game function.

Referring again toFIG. 1, when, for example, the first pedal22on the left side of integ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12is being used for certain game function control, the switch16associated with the selected function and the corresponding indicator light18will illuminate to show an “L” and indicator light20will illuminate to show a “1” on the programmable hand-held video gaming controller. Further, in another embodiment, a corresponding upright pedal function indicator light “A”30or an inverter pedal function indicator light “B”32, will illuminate on the corresponding pedal (i.e.,22) on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12, depending on which setting the pedal function inverter switch34is set to. This, advantageously, alerts players as to which setting the pedal function inverter switch34is set to, either upright function or inverted function. This feature allows the gamer to access two different gaming functions per foot pedal.

An exemplary use of the pedal function inverter switch34is, in one embodiment, each time a player activates game function transfer switch16on programmable hand-held video gaming controller10, it transfers two functions to a rocker pedal, one at the top of the pedal and one at the bottom of the pedal. With pedal function inverter switch34, the player can choose to reverse those two functions if they wish. For example, if the player transferred the gas and brake functions of an automobile-based video game to a rocker pedal and the brake function was at the top of the pedal and the gas function was at the bottom of the pedal, a player may choose to reverse these two functions so the gas function is at the top of the rocker pedal and the brake function is at the bottom of the pedal. This would allow any control function on gaming controller10to be transferred to (or coupled to) the top or the bottom of any rocker pedal, thereby doubling a player's options.

When, for example, the second pedal24on the left side of the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12is being used for certain game function control, the push button for the selected function will be illuminated and the corresponding indicator18will illuminate with an “L” and corresponding indicator20will illuminate with a “2” on the programmable hand-held video gaming controller. Also, the corresponding “A”30or “B”32indicator lights for pedal24(indicated as “2” on the hand-held game controller because it is the second foot pedal) will illuminate on the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12, alerting a player to which setting the pedal function inverter switch34is set to, i.e., either upright function or inverted function. Thus, for example, when control of a game function has been given to the second pedal28on the right side of the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12, the push button for the selected function in the game function activation area illuminates and the corresponding indicator18will show an “R” and indicator20will show a “2”. In one embodiment, function inverter switch34indicator light “A”30or “B”32will be also illuminated on the integrated foot pedal gaming platform12. In this fashion, the indicator lights fully alert the gamer as to which pedals have taken over, or are sharing control, each game function.

In one embodiment, hand-held game controller10may include an on/off push button switch36that activates and deactivates a setting lock on all programmable hand-held video gaming controller functions and illuminates corresponding on/off indicator lights. In one embodiment, on/off push button switch36requires players to hold the switch36for a predetermined amount of time, e.g., two seconds, to switch on or off the function and to prevent unwanted changes to the settings.

In one embodiment, game controller10includes a two player selector switch38that allows two players, each equipped with a programmable hand-held video gaming controller10, to choose either left side pedals (either the first pedal and/or the second pedal on the left side) or right side pedals (either the first pedal and/or the second pedal on the right side) on the integrated foot-pedal gaming controller platform12. The use of the player selector switches38thus limits the programmable hand-held video gaming controller functions to either the selected left side pedals “1” and “2” or right side pedals “1” and “2” of the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12thereby allowing two players to play side-by-side with the use of two pedals each.

As discussed herein, in certain embodiments, the programmable hand-held video gaming controller10may transfer the activated function to the integrated foot pedal controller platform12or instead of transferring game function control to the foot pedals, control can be shared between game controller10and the foot pedals of integrated foot pedal controller platform12.

Referring toFIG. 2, in one embodiment, one or more of the pedals of integrated foot-pedal gaming controller platform12may be dual operation rocker pedals that allow a player to rock the pedal forward or backwards to perform two separate programmable hand-held video gaming controller functions with one pedal. Pedal function inverter switch34allows a player to reverse pedal function from upright pedal function to inverted pedal function. Pedal function indicator light “A”30indicates the upright foot pedal function while pedal function indicator light “B”32indicates the inverted foot pedal function. Two-player indicator light18on programmable hand-held video gaming controller10will illuminate an “L” when a player chooses to use the left side pedals ‘1”22and “2”24on the integrated foot pedal gaming platform12. Two-player indicator light18will illuminate “R” when a player chooses to use the right side pedals “1”26and “2”28on the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12. In one embodiment, when a player chooses the two-player indicator light “L” or the two player indicator light “R” setting on the programmable hand-held video gaming controller10it will also activate and illuminate the two-player switch40on the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12, thus alerting the player that the two-player switch has been activated on the programmable hand-held video gaming controller10.

In other embodiments, variations of the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12may include single function pedals, dual operation rocker pedals, quad-operation (4-way) rocker pedals or combinations of two or more. Other variations of the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12may be modified to fit into a gaming chair, in place of an adjustable hinged connecting frame that forms the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12.

In another embodiment, variations of the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12, may be incorporated into footwear. For example, in one embodiment; rather than having rocker pedals mounted on a deck platform, a “dual-function” rocker pedal mechanism may be incorporated in the construction of a gaming shoe. This allows a player to control two traditional hand-held video gaming controller functions by resting the sole of the shoe on a firm surface and rocking their foot forward or backward.

Integ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12may also include an adjustable hinged connecting frame42that supports the integrated foot-pedal gaming controller platform12, adjusts for pitch, and is configured to fold for easy transportation.

In one embodiment, integ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12can be comprised of two separate panels (indicated by dashed lines44) that can slide apart on rails thus extending the length of integ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12for two-player action. Alternately, integ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12can be comprised of only one panel with two pedals as indicated by the dashed lines46. Handles48may be positioned atop integ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form12or a single handle48may be positioned atop integrated foot pedal gaming controller12to allow for easy transportation.

FIG. 3illustrates an exemplary layout of an alternate programmable hand-held video gaming controller10of the present disclosure. The game controller10illustrated inFIG. 3is similar to the game controller10shown inFIG. 1except that the game controller10inFIG. 3is for use with a two-pedal integ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form14. A seen, indicator lights20can illuminate as either a “1” or a “2” to identify which foot pedal on integ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form14has been transferred (or is sharing) control of that particular gaming function.

Claims

  1. A gaming platform, comprising: a programmable hand-held video gaming controller comprising: at least one game function activation area, each of the at least one game function activation areas operating a game function, each of the at least one game function activation areas further comprising a function control transfer switch;and an integrated foot-pedal gaming controller platform in electrical communication with the programmable hand-held video gaming controller, the integrated foot-pedal gaming controller platform comprising: at least one foot pedal configured to control at least one game function of the programmable hand-held video gaming controller when a corresponding function control transfer switch on the programmable hand-held video gaming controller is activated, wherein at least one pedal of the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form is a dual function rocker pedal and includes a function inverter switch enabling a user to toggle between upright pedal function and inverted pedal function.
  1. The gaming platform of claim 1 , wherein each function control transfer switch is configured to transfer control of the game function to different foot pedals on the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form upon successive activations of the function control transfer switch.
  2. The gaming platform of claim 1 , wherein the function control transfer switch is configured to transfer control of the game function associated with the function control transfer switch to the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form and disable control of the game function on the programmable hand-held video gaming controller.
  3. The gaming platform of claim 1 , wherein each pedal on the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form further includes an upright pedal function indicator to indicate that the pedal is set to an upright pedal function and an inverted pedal function indicator to indicate that the pedal is set to an inverted pedal function.
  4. The gaming platform of claim 1 , wherein the integrated foot pedal gaming platform is adaptable for use with multiple programmable hand-held video gaming controllers.
  5. The gaming platform of claim 1 , wherein the dual function rocker pedal is incorporated in a gaming shoe.
  6. A gaming platform, comprising: a programmable hand-held video gaming controller comprising: at least one game function activation area, each of the at least one game function activation areas operating a game function, each of the at least one game function activation areas further comprising a function control transfer switch;and an integrated foot-pedal gaming controller platform in electrical communication with the programmable hand-held video gaming controller, the integrated foot-pedal gaming controller platform comprising: at least one foot pedal configured to control at least one game function when a corresponding function control transfer switch on the programmable hand-held video gaming controller is activated, wherein the function control transfer switch is configured to transfer control of the game function associated with the function control transfer switch to the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form while maintaining control of the game function on the programmable hand-held video gaming controller, thereby allowing the game function to be shared between the programmable hand-held video gaming controller and the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form.
  7. A gaming platform, comprising: a programmable hand-held video gaming controller comprising: at least one game function activation area, each of the at least one game function activation areas operating a game function, each of the at least one game function activation areas further comprising a function control transfer switch;and an integrated foot-pedal gaming controller platform in electrical communication with the programmable hand-held video gaming controller, the integrated foot-pedal gaming controller platform comprising: at least one foot pedal configured to control at least one game function when a corresponding function control transfer switch on the programmable hand-held video gaming controller is activated, wherein the at least one game function activation area further comprises at least one indicator light configured to indicate which pedal on the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form control of the game function associated with the game function activation area has been transferred to.
  8. A gaming method for sharing or transferring gaming function control between a programmable hand-held video gaming controller and an integrated foot-pedal gaming controller platform, the method comprising: activating a function control transfer switch located on a game function activation area of the programmable hand-held video gaming controller, the activation of the function control transfer switch transferring control of the gaming function associated with the game function activation area to a corresponding foot pedal on the integrated foot-pedal gaming controller platform, and transferring control of the game function associated with the function control transfer switch to the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form and maintaining control of the game function on the programmable hand-held video gaming controller, thereby allowing the game function to be shared between the programmable hand-held video gaming controller and the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form.
  9. The method of claim 9 , further comprising transferring control of the game function to different foot pedals on the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form upon successive activations of the function control transfer switch.
  10. The method of claim 9 , further comprising transferring control of the game function associated with the function control transfer switch to the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form and disabling control of the game function on the programmable hand-held video gaming controller.
  11. The method of claim 9 , further comprising providing an indication of which pedal on the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form control of the game function associated with the game function activation area has been transferred to.
  12. A gaming platform, comprising: a programmable hand-held video gaming controller comprising: at least one game function activation area, each of the at least one game function activation areas operating a game function, each of the at least one game function activation areas further comprising: a function control transfer switch configured to transfer control of the game function to different foot pedals on an integ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form upon successive activations of the function control transfer switch;and at least one indicator light configured to indicate which pedal on the integrated foot pedal gaming controller platform control of the game function associated with the game function activation area has been transferred to;and the integrated foot-pedal gaming controller platform in electrical communication with the programmable hand-held video gaming controller, the integrated foot-pedal gaming controller platform comprising: at least one foot pedal configured to control at least one game function when a corresponding function control transfer switch on the programmable hand-held video gaming controller is activated.
